Findings– Globalization and the seemingly incessant advances in technology have helped make the competitive environment increasingly challenging for businesses today. But these are not the only issues. Companies in addition have to cope with demographic shifts. The workforce is aging, and there is a shortage of young workers available to fill the voids left by retirements. Under the circumstances, retaining existing talent accrues even more importance. The value of talent is indisputable. It can prove hard for others to replicate and might also be utilized strategically in the quest to achieve success for the firm.
